I wish the acoustics were better in the Palumbo than they are. The sound seems to bounce around the hard surfaces of the Palumbo's interior. Perhaps not much can be done to change that; however, I wonder if it's possible to play the recorded music at a considerably lower volume. I know my hearing is not as good as when I was younger, but not so bad that I need to have the volume turned up as high as it is now played in order for me to hear it. Who do you recommend that my complaint should best be addressed? I've heard many fans complain about the excessive volume of the recorded music.
Also I wonder why it's not possible to give the score of one of the Dukes' basketball teams who is playing out to town on the same day and time as a when the other team is playing at the Palumbo. On Wednesday, Jan 13th the extremely successful women's team is playing at RI at the very same time that the men's team will be playing St. Louis on the Bluff. Could you provide score updates on the women's game during time time outs? With all of those people sitting at the scorer's table, there has to be someone who has the time to track the score of the out of town game. Even better, why can't that very expensive 4-screen video scoreboard hanging above the center circle post the women's score throughout the evening? By the way, that scoreboard failed to show the individual players' stats for the entire women's game against Fordham on Sunday. Do you know the reason for this?
All of these issues if resolved will help improve the fans' experience when attending a game at the Palumbo, but not as much as having a winning program!
